Tools Required

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2007 Cadillac DTS.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

J 21177-A  Drum to Brake Shoe Clearance Gage. See Special Tools .

CAUTION: Refer to Brake Dust Caution .

The park brake cable is self-adjusting. No cable adjustment is needed.

The park brake shoes require adjustment.

  1. Set the J 21177-A  to the inside diameter of the rear brake rotor (1). See Special Tools .

  2. Position the J 21177-A  . See Special Tools .
  3. Turn the adjuster nut until the lining (1) just contacts the J 21177-A  . See Special Tools .
  4. Repeat steps 1 through 3 for the opposite side.
  5. The clearance between the park brake shoe and the rotor is 0.660 mm 0.026 inches.
